I have driven both and now I drive the 2.0 L and I love it. For one, the engine is the same as the Euro Ford concentrate z tec, which we can not get here in N. America. The 2.3 L engine is built by Mazda. The difference in hp is negligeable 150 vs 160 you really can not feel it when driving. Personally, I LOVE the way my M3 sounds, the manual transmission makes it growl : on takeoff I had people ask me if I had a hole in the exhaust and what kind of aftermarket muffler I had on. The sound at highway speeds is normal primarily coming from the stock tires, which aren't the best.
Other differences on the 2.3L include the 17" rims costly tires, bigger brakes and a firmer suspension, great for turning at higher speeds. if you care about that depends on what you plan on doing with the car.
